Output 76bc499edf8929483d53d79e3c371323ed5a747076111af046e1f3e28bcb7cde:389

value
33489
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f0f53efe93d34946d9ce6753b37011b260dbfeb254553e2c37dcabcabe072ca2
address
bc1p7r6nal5n6dy5dkwwvafmxuq3kfsdhl4j232nutphmj4u40s89j3q920waq
transaction
76bc499edf8929483d53d79e3c371323ed5a747076111af046e1f3e28bcb7cde
confirmations
80362
spent
true